在搜索引擎优化(SEO)领域,蜘蛛池(Spider Pool)是一种通过模拟搜索引擎爬虫行为,对网站进行抓取、索引和收录的技术,通过合理地利用蜘蛛池,网站管理员可以加速网站内容的收录,提高网站在搜索引擎中的排名,本文将详细介绍蜘蛛池的工作原理、实现方法以及优化策略,帮助读者更好地理解和应用这一技术。
一、蜘蛛池的基本原理
蜘蛛池,顾名思义,是模拟搜索引擎爬虫(Spider)行为的工具或平台,搜索引擎爬虫是搜索引擎用来抓取互联网上各种类型网页的自动化程序,它们通过访问网站、抓取页面内容、分析链接结构,将收集到的信息带回搜索引擎的索引库,以便用户进行搜索查询。
蜘蛛池通过模拟这些爬虫的行为,对目标网站进行抓取和收录,它通常包括以下几个关键步骤:
1、爬虫配置:定义爬虫的抓取规则、目标网站、抓取频率等。
2、页面抓取:按照规则对目标网站进行页面抓取,获取HTML内容。
3、内容解析:对抓取到的HTML内容进行解析,提取文本、链接、图片等有用信息。
4、数据整合:将解析到的数据整合到蜘蛛池的数据库中,供后续处理和分析。
5、数据提交:将抓取到的数据提交给搜索引擎,请求其进行收录和索引。
二、实现蜘蛛池收录的步骤
要实现蜘蛛池的收录功能,需要按照以下步骤进行:
1. 选择合适的工具或平台
需要选择一个合适的工具或平台来构建蜘蛛池,常用的工具包括Scrapy(一个强大的爬虫框架)、Heritrix(一个基于Java的开源爬虫)、以及各类商业爬虫工具,这些工具提供了丰富的接口和插件,可以方便地定制和扩展爬虫功能。
2. 配置爬虫参数
根据目标网站的特点和需求,配置爬虫的参数,这些参数包括:
抓取频率:控制爬虫访问目标网站的频率,避免对目标网站造成过大的负担。
抓取深度:定义爬虫的抓取层级,即爬取到第几层链接为止。
用户代理:设置模拟浏览器的用户代理,以绕过目标网站的访问限制。
请求头:自定义请求头信息,以模拟真实用户的访问行为。
3. 编写爬虫脚本
根据选择的工具或平台,编写相应的爬虫脚本,以下是一个使用Scrapy框架的简单示例:
import scrapy from scrapy.spiders import CrawlSpider, Rule from scrapy.linkextractors import LinkExtractor class MySpider(CrawlSpider): name = 'my_spider' allowed_domains = ['example.com'] start_urls = ['http://www.example.com'] rules = ( Rule(LinkExtractor(allow=()), callback='parse_item', follow=True), ) def parse_item(self, response): # 提取页面中的有用信息并生成Item对象 item = { 'title': response.xpath('//title/text()').get(), 'url': response.url, 'content': response.xpath('//body//text()').getall(), # 提取页面正文内容 } yield item
4. 运行爬虫并监控进度
运行爬虫脚本后,需要实时监控爬虫的进度和状态,确保爬虫能够顺利运行并抓取到目标数据,常用的监控工具包括Scrapy的内置日志系统、第三方监控平台等,还需要关注目标网站的访问日志和封禁情况,及时调整爬虫策略以避免被封禁。
5. 数据提交与收录优化
在爬虫抓取到数据后,需要将数据提交给搜索引擎进行收录和索引,常用的方法包括:
直接提交:通过搜索引擎提供的API接口(如Google Search Console的URL提交功能)直接提交URL和页面内容,这种方法适用于数据量较小的情况,但需要注意的是,不同搜索引擎的API接口可能有所不同,需要根据具体情况进行调整和优化,Google Search Console的URL提交功能允许每天最多提交1000个URL;而Bing Webmaster Tools则提供了更丰富的接口和功能,在选择提交方式时需要综合考虑各种因素,还可以考虑使用第三方工具或服务来辅助完成数据提交工作,这些工具通常提供批量提交、定时提交等功能,能够大大提高数据提交的效率和准确性。“SEO推推”等第三方工具就提供了这样的服务,但需要注意的是,使用第三方工具时需要谨慎选择可靠的平台和服务商以确保数据安全性和隐私性不受侵犯,同时还需要关注平台的稳定性和可靠性以避免因平台故障导致的数据丢失或提交失败等问题发生,另外需要注意的是,在提交数据时还需要遵循搜索引擎的规范和政策以确保数据的合法性和合规性,例如避免重复提交、避免恶意刷量等行为的发生等,通过遵循这些规范和政策可以确保数据的顺利收录并提高网站在搜索引擎中的排名和曝光度,同时还需要关注搜索引擎算法的变化和更新以及时调整优化策略以适应新的变化和挑战,例如近年来随着人工智能技术的不断发展搜索引擎算法也在不断更新迭代以适应新的需求和环境变化等情况下需要密切关注并调整优化策略以保持竞争优势和领先地位等目标实现等任务完成等目标达成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成等任务完成}
【小恐龙蜘蛛池认准唯一TG: seodinggg】XiaoKongLongZZC